Trustees voted to adopt resolution 2526-52 expressing district support for a countywide continuation of Measure C, saying the measure would prioritize local streets and safe routes to schools; the board recorded the motion and approved the resolution on April 14.

The Central Unified School District Board of Trustees voted April 14 to adopt Resolution 2526-52 supporting the countywide "Better Roads, Safe Streets" transportation measure, which trustees said continues, rather than raises, a prior transportation tax.
